its possible (but not ideal) to go back to the vanilla font, but implementing a new font is a lot of work

also going back to the vanilla font will break a thing or two, for instance you will no longer be able to use the controller button mod with it for now (the creator of enhanced stock UI is currently working on that mod for the vanilla font spacing)


the UI has tons of (hext) code in it that changes the windows to make the font work (among other things), so you'll have to delete the font files, chunk1 files (also alters dialogue windows, in a different way than the hext code), remove all hext code that breaks the vanilla font, then repackage the .iro...

Hi satsuki, thank you so much for the mod it looks great. However I've got one problem. I can load it alright with the Reunion mod, but everytime I open the game, being in fullscreen mode or not, the in-game screen is always oversized comparing to the windowed screen and I don't know if it's because of the Reunion configuration or not because I've tried to change it as much as I can and it's still like that.

Can you recommmend any way to fix this? Thanks!

go to your The_Reunion folder and find options.ini, right click it and hit edit

full_screen = y
window_x = 0
window_y = 0
window_width = 1920
window_height = 1080
preserve_aspect = y

where i have the 1920 and 1080, change those to your desktop resolution and see if that fixes it
(if your resolution happens to be 1920x1080 then you can just use those exact values)

if you happen to have more problems with this, you should go to ff7.live and click the link to join our discord, since this is a reunion config issue and has nothing to do with satsuki's mod

Does anyone know any workaround for the d-pad/shoulders not working on a DS4?

So far, from scattered internet references I've tried:

1. Disabling every potential overlay (Steam, GeForce, Discord, etc) -- Result: No effect
2. Disabling Analog Support in the .ini file -- Result: Depends (see below), but typically no effect
3. Unplugging controller and plugging it in after the game has started -- Result: Game never detects controller unless it was plugged in before launch (so the controller doesn't work at all)
4. Enable DS4 support in Steam/use "forced on" in the per-game settings -- Result: If (and only if) I disable analog support in the .ini, this enables d-pad provided I rebind the d-pad to stick directions via steam controller configuration BUT the game double reads inputs from other buttons. If analog support is enabled this has no effect except the face buttons are scrambled to incorrect locations (e.g. X becomes Square, Circle becomes X etc). Technically the face button scramble happens if analog support is disabled too, but the double button read means it will read one version of the button immediately followed by the incorrect version.

Interestingly, even if I disable analog support in the .ini, the analog stick still works fine and absolutely nothing changes about the controller behavior.

E: It seems like the buttons are still slightly scrambled with steam controller stuff off. It swaps Square and Circle (X and B), enabling Steam support on will scramble them further. Interestingly, enabling vibration in the in-game config will also scramble the buttons to the steam support variant as opposed to the regular scramble for... some reason?

E: Further testing -- without Moguri installed I get the "walk left" issue, and the buttons are scrambled as if I had steam controller support on. Weirdly, the shoulder buttons don't work with vanilla, but the D-pad partially works. Left/Right are registered as up/down, and up/down seem functionless.

i have successfully implemented 2 different monospaced fonts in reunion, because it does away with window.bin and uses a hext file template
to change the font spacing

however, to do this for the vanilla game (and therefore to be able to release my fonts for 7h) i cant use hext

i've been told i need to uncompress window.bin, then edit the font spacing portion, and recompress it
